See If State Farm Has Insurance For Your Favorite Cruiser
Motorcycle insurance may be a good idea whether you're riding from Rathdrum, Idaho to Country Homes, Washington, Durango to Ridgeway in Colorado, or enjoying a different scenic route. The coverage options available with State Farm may be able to help if the unexpected occurs like bodily injury to someone else when riding your motorcycle or fire. It may also be able to assist with trip interruption expenses, depending on your policy.
